Rafizi on pink diamond: It's Najib's word against DoJ filing


  • Nation
  • Thursday, 11 Apr 2019

SEREMBAN: Although the government has confirmed that Datin Seri Rosmah Mansor did not purchase a 22-carat pink diamond, this does not cancel out the fact that the jewel was nonetheless eventually bought with funds allegedly siphoned from 1Malaysia Development Bhd (1MDB), says Rafizi Ramli.

The PKR vice-president said the fact remained that in 2017, there were filings by the United States' Department of Justice (DoJ) in a civil lawsuit, which alleged that 1MDB funds were used to purchase the US$27mil (RM110mil) pink diamond to be gifted to the former premier's wife.
